Title: VMMaker not seeing driver
Post by: dth930 on January 24, 2021, 02:05:26 pm
I'm trying to get a new install working on Win10.  I have an AMD Radeon 6670 card and am using Emudriver & tools 2.0 beta 15. 

I've installed the emudriver and rebooted.  When I go into it now, it correctly shows AMD Radeon 6670 and gives me the Uninstall option.  In Device Manager I see AMD Radeon 6670 also.  I have not installed any other drivers for the GPU (besides whatever Windows may have installed automatically).  However, when I go into VMMaker it tells me "No compatible driver found".  It only lists DISPLAY1 - Microsoft basic display driver.

I don't have any options for EDID emulation in the settings.  (though I should given the card I'm using)

I can go through the setup and generate modes for my display (a WG 25K7401, set as a K7000) but after it's done the option to Install Modes isn't enabled.

Am I missing a step somewhere?  Do I need to install any AMD drivers?

I should mention that I'm using the beta 15 release with Adrenalin 18.5.1.  I tried uninstalling and then installing using beta 15 with Adrenalin 16.2.1 but when I try that Emudriver doesn't find my card at all.

I started with a clean Windows 10 Pro install, so there are no legacy drivers around.

The correct version for your card is 16.2.1. Maybe your card's pci id is not listed as compatible (post it here just in case). Have you tried a forced installation from the hardware manager?

These are IDs that are being reported:

PCI\VEN_1002&DEV_6758&SUBSYS_0B0E1028&REV_00
PCI\VEN_1002&DEV_6758&SUBSYS_0B0E1028
PCI\VEN_1002&DEV_6758&CC_030000
PCI\VEN_1002&DEV_6758&CC_0300

When I try to force the driver to update to Emudriver from device manager I get a notice that Windows confirmed that the best driver for my hardware is already installed.  The closest I see in the included driver pack is the 6570, but that's definitely not what I have.

It's weird that 18.5 sees it but 16.2 doesn't.  Is it possible that the mistaken installation of 18.5 left some remnants that's causing 16.2 not to see it?

16.2.1 definitely has that ID included. But there are 2 versions of the package, make sure you got the one for non-GCN cards, use this link (https://drive.google.com/file/d/1LBri2u2oeJ-kNxf9-qG0blTDi_t5C0sc/view?usp=sharing).

That was the problem.  When I was initially downloading the versions weren't clear from the filenames, but it makes sense now.
